Is there any relatively inexpensive place to purchase spare stock batteries?
If you go into a Sprint Corporate store, and ask for a spare battery, they will give you one at no charge. I have done this for my touch pro. I also purchased the 1500mAh Seidio (before I knew about the free ones at the Sprint store)I now have 3 batteires for it. I would like to find a charger that will charge multiple HTC batteries. The only one I have seen, that comes close, is a desktop cradle that will charge the one in the phone and one spare. BTW, the Seidio battery is not the same exact size as the OEM. Some have said that it is larger but, it is actually a hair smaller. The OEM batteries will not fall out of the phone when it is turned over, with the cover off. The Seidio will fall out immediately. The thickness of the battery on a side by side comparison is the same to the naked eye. It would taske a micrometer or set of caliplers to see the difference for it is a mere few thousands of an inch in comparison.
